  • This is my vintage pc DTK Computer, a midtower with a 533mhz Celeron Mendocino socket 370, ATI Radeon 9000 AGP video card, and ESS ES1869 ISA Sound Card.
    It is a versatile retro pc that can run retro games from Test Drive 3 to F-22 Lightning II, Screamer 2, Colin McRae or Quake 2.
